Charles Erben, Richmond, to [?] Ritchie, Brandon, 1897 December 2

 File — Box: 2, Folder: 158
Identifier: id88339

Scope and Contents

Scope and Contents

Inquiry about Isabella Harrison's health; Charles' suffering due to "consumption of the jaw"; "idea of putting the Cabin Point organ in the Claremont Church"; offer to acquire an organ or piano for the new school house; anticipation of "a weeks shooting in January down on the James River". 2 pp. ALS.
